| ##===- source/Plugins/Makefile -----------------------------*- Makefile -*-===## |
| # |
| # The LLVM Compiler Infrastructure |
| # |
| # This file is distributed under the University of Illinois Open Source |
| # License. See LICENSE.TXT for details. |
| # |
| ##===----------------------------------------------------------------------===## |
| |
| LLDB_LEVEL := ../.. |
| |
| include $(LLDB_LEVEL)/../../Makefile.config |
| |
| |
| DIRS := ABI/MacOSX-arm ABI/MacOSX-i386 ABI/SysV-x86_64 Disassembler/llvm \ |
| ObjectContainer/BSD-Archive ObjectFile/ELF ObjectFile/PECOFF \ |
| SymbolFile/DWARF SymbolFile/Symtab Process/Utility \ |
| DynamicLoader/Static Platform Process/gdb-remote Instruction/ARM \ |
| UnwindAssembly/InstEmulation UnwindAssembly/x86 \ |
| LanguageRuntime/CPlusPlus/ItaniumABI \ |
| LanguageRuntime/ObjC/AppleObjCRuntime \ |
| DynamicLoader/POSIX-DYLD \ |
| OperatingSystem/Python |
| |
| ifeq ($(HOST_OS),Darwin) |
| DIRS += Process/MacOSX-Kernel |
| DIRS += DynamicLoader/MacOSX-DYLD DynamicLoader/Darwin-Kernel |
| DIRS += ObjectContainer/Universal-Mach-O ObjectFile/Mach-O |
| DIRS += SymbolVendor/MacOSX |
| #DIRS += Process/MacOSX-User |
| DIRS += Process/mach-core |
| endif |
| |
| ifeq ($(HOST_OS),Linux) |
| DIRS += DynamicLoader/MacOSX-DYLD DynamicLoader/Darwin-Kernel |
| DIRS += Process/Linux Process/POSIX |
| endif |
| |
| ifeq ($(HOST_OS),FreeBSD) |
| DIRS += Process/FreeBSD Process/POSIX |
| endif |
| |
| include $(LLDB_LEVEL)/Makefile |